1809‐73 (Bunka 6‐Meiji 6) He was a Shogunate councilor and lord of Miyazu Domain in Tango during the late Edo period. He was the adopted son of Muneharu. He succeeded to the title in 1840 (Tenpo 11) and was called Hoki no Kami. He worked to restore the government of the domain, and in 1858 (Ansei 5) he was appointed Magistrate of Temples and Shrines. He also interrogated the patriots who had been captured during the Ansei Purge as one of the five crimes. In 1862 (Bunkyu 2) when those involved in the Purge began to be denounced, he was relieved of his position as Shoshidai and demoted from Tamama to Ganma. However, he was appointed Councilor in 1864 (Genji 1) and was involved in the first Choshu Expedition, and was on the front lines as Councilor in the second Choshu Expedition in 1866 (Keio 2).
